Kayla 'K.M.' Herbert was born in Northern Ontario, Canada and lives in Yorkshire, England. Her debut novel, The Book of Moons, was published in 2020 by Fisher King Publishing. She self-published her poetry collection, Between the Spaces, in 2022 and her poems have been been featured in anthologies by Leeds Trinity University and Twisted Ink. She has performed her work at the Ilkley Literature Festival, Leeds Art Gallery and Craven Arts. She has a BA in English Literature from McGill University and an MA in Creative Writing at Manchester Metropolitan University. In 2023, her work-in-progress, Behind the Green Sky, won a Society of Children's Book Writers and Illustrators Margaret Carey scholarship and was longlisted for WriteMentor's Novel-in-Development Award.

Her most recent work-in-progress, A Dance of Sun and Stars, was longlisted for Mslexia's 2024 Children's and YA Novel Competition and made the Top 100 in The Bath Novel Award 2025. Off the page, Kayla is a professional marketer in the arts industry and a qualified Dru yoga teacher, specialising in breathwork and therapeutic movement. When she isn't working or writing, she can usually be found practising yoga in the woods or birdwatching with her very patient spaniel, Brontë.
